A tercentenary celebration of the Concert Spirituel, France's first commercial public subscription concert series held in Paris during religious holidays when staged works were forbidden. It immediately became a prestigious avenue for composers and virtuoso performers, as well as an important cornerstone in the development of both sacred and secular French baroque music.
Award-winning period-instrument ensemble Charivari Agréable — Gabriel Alves/Dan Watts (baroque flute & recorder), Fernando Santiago (baroque violin), Pablo Tejedor Gutiérrez (viola da gamba), and Kah-Ming Ng (harpsichord) — perform:

Pierre Danican Philidor: Trio sonata in C op.1/3
Louis-Antoine Dornel: Suitte en Trio in A op.1/2
Jean-Fery Rebel: Les Elémens
Georg Philipp Telemann: Paris Quartets
and excerpts by Jean-Marie Leclair, Jean-Baptiste Antoine Forqueray & Jean-Philippe Rameau
